Vicodin Addiction

Can you overcome Serious vicodin addiction (10 to 12 pills a day) without checking into rehab and what physical effects should I expect?

I was taking 20 to 25 a day 10/325 Norco's, same as Vic's just less acetomenephine. You can stop. It will take you 5 to 7 days to get past the physical part of the withdrawls. Another 30 to 90 days to get past all of the mental aspects, fatigue and insomnia. If you have no other underlying health issues, there is no dangers in stopping cold turkey.

The symptoms you could have would be...
Insomnia
nausea
vomitting
sneezing
yawning
watery eyes
diherea(sp)
Restless leg syndrom
muscle aches
joint pain
lower back pain
muscle twitching/tremors
anxiety
mental cravings
no appetite

Most of these will subside by the fifth day and you will start feeling much better, then the real work begins.

Have you looked into any type of aftercare?

Good luck!
